The atomic structure is a fundamental concept in atomic physics. The Rutherford model, proposed by Ernest Rutherford in 1911, describes the atom as a small, dense nucleus surrounded by electrons. The Bohr model, proposed by Niels Bohr in 1913, introduced energy quantization and electron spin. Quantum mechanics, developed by Schrödinger, Heisenberg, and Dirac, provides a comprehensive framework for understanding atomic structure.

by J.B. Rajam (often referred to as Atomic Physics by J.B. Rajam, D.Sc.) is a landmark, comprehensive textbook for undergraduate and postgraduate physics students, particularly in India. Known for its academic rigor, detailed derivations, and exhaustive coverage of both classical and early quantum atomic models, this book has been a staple in academic curricula for decades.
